Crime overview

Scholars Road area has the lowest crime rate of 43 local areas in Clapham Common & Abbeville , and the 18th lowest crime rate of 768 local areas in Lambeth .

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.

The overall crime rate in the area around Scholars Road (SW12 0PG) in the last 12 months was 18.3 per 1,000 residents and was 82.0% lower than the Clapham Common & Abbeville average (101.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Other theft with 2 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.

In the area around Scholars Road (SW12 0PG),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Ethelbert Street, where police recorded 23 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Molly Huggins Close (10 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
